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49232306 226741 42928948679 906 914787
7613387 80352
7613387 80352
59550 193814027 651804246
All about undefined
Interested in learning more?
7613387 80352
59550 193814027 651804246
See more
45752657 19814
383805313 82308119 54056
See more
827844 113757448 55622629
132654231 604696 3536972 1875
See more